Software Engineer I
Posted 2025-08-15
Remote, USA
Full Time
Immediate Start
Job Summary:
You work on a team building and maintaining the custom software which runs Little Caesars. Whether remote or on site, you will be part of all aspects of the Software Development Lifecycle including technical design, development, testing and support.
Focus on building expertise in one area of software development technology. This position will operate with specific guidance from more experienced levels of Engineers. This position may support LCE or other Ilitch companies.
Key Responsibilities:
• Participate in the design, development, and support of technical projects through to completion according to project and corporate standards and methodologies.
• Complete software development tasks such as small changes or enhancements to existing systems with specific guidance and mentoring from more senior developers.
• Translate user stories into clear code
• Craft code which is free of obvious or glaring errors
• Analyze, navigate, and understand functions and classes/modules written by others
• Participate in all aspects of agile software development including sprint-planning, story review and demos.
• Regularly pair with more senior developers while completing development assignments.
• Support Quality Assurance (QA) in the development of integration test plans, test conditions, and expected test results.
• Collaborate with Product Owners to understand tasks and user stories.
• Resolve system issues and respond to suggestions for improvements.
• Provide support for production applications including on-call afterhours support on a rotational basis. Develop and maintain support documentation.
Required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:
•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field. Equivalent experience may be considered in lieu of a formal education.
• Programming experience in a professional or school environment or relevant business experience.
• Relationship building skills and ability to collaborate with other IT staff and business units.
• Evidence of effective verbal and written communication skills.
• Evidence of a self-motivated, curious and creative approach to technology with a passionate embrace of technology.
Preferred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:
• Understanding of a formal Software Development Life Cycle using agile processes.
• One (1) year of experience in any of the following technologies:
• HTML / JavaScript / CSS/ React / TypeScript
• C# / .Net Core
• Node.js
• Open-source JavaScript libraries
• Data storage technologies including RDMSs, No-SQL databases and unstructured storage
• REST APIs
• Android mobile application development using Kotlin or Java
• iOS mobile application development using or Swift or Objective-C
• Java
• Python
• Coding for embedded systems with preemptive, multitasking RTOS in a language such as C++
• Microservices
• Azure cloud platform or equivalents such as AWS or GCP
• Understanding of source control technologies such as GIT
Working Conditions:
• This position will require working non-traditional hours including evenings, weekends and holidays.
• May work remote or in a normal office environment where there is no physical discomfort due to temperature, noise, dust and the like.
• Moderate noise (examples: business office with computers and printers.
• Some travel including travel to restaurant locations and trade shows. This position requires the ability to adhere to the LCE Travel policy.
